Empowering Non-Profit Organizations with Microsoft Power Apps.
Power Apps
Non-profit organizations often face unique challenges requiring efficient data management, streamlined processes, and meaningful stakeholder engagement. Microsoft Power Apps provides a robust platform for creating custom applications without extensive coding knowledge. In this this article love how Microsoft Power Apps can benefit non-profit organizations by empowering them to build tailored solutions, streamline operations, and enhance engagement with volunteers, donors, and beneficiaries.
1. Tailored Solutions for Unique Needs:
Non-profit organizations have diverse operational requirements and processes that off-the-shelf software solutions may not fully address. Microsoft Power Apps allows non-profits to build custom applications tailored to their needs. Whether it's man volunteer sign-ups, tracking program outcomes, or streamlining donation management, Power Apps provides a flexible platform to create intuitive and user-friendly applications without the need for extensive coding. Non-profits can build solutions aligning with their unique workflows, improving efficiency and productivity.
2. Streamlining Operations and Workflows:
Non-profit organizations rely on manual processes and disparate systems, leading to inefficiencies and data silos. With Microsoft Power Apps, non-profits can automate and streamline their operations by replacing manual processes with digital applications. Power Apps enables the creation of forms, workflows, and approval processes that automate tasks such as data entry, document approvals, and resource allocation. By digitizing and automating these processes, non-profits can save time, reduce errors, and optimize resource allocation, allowing them to focus more on their core mission.
3. Mobile Access and Remote Capabilities:
Non-profit organizations are increasingly embracing remote work and require solutions that support mobility. Microsoft Power Apps offers mobile-friendly applications that can be accessed on various devices, including smartphones and tablets. Non-profit staff members, volunteers, and field workers can access critical information, update data, and perform tasks on the go. This flexibility empowers non-profits to operate efficiently, regardless of their physical location, and enhances the productivity of their remote teams.
4. Data Collection and Reporting:
Accurate data collection and reporting are vital for non-profit organizations to measure their impact and make informed decisions. Power Apps allows non-profits to create custom data collection forms, surveys, and questionnaires that capture relevant information directly into their databases. This data can be easily analyzed, visualized, and shared using Microsoft Power BI, enabling non-profits to gain valuable insights into their operations, track outcomes, and demonstrate their impact to stakeholders.
5. Enhanced Engagement and Communication:
Non-profit organizations thrive on effective communication and engagement with their stakeholders, including volunteers, donors, and beneficiaries. Microsoft Power Apps facilitates this engagement by providing tools to build interactive applications that foster communication, feedback, and collaboration. For example, non-profits can create volunteer management apps that allow volunteers to sign up for events, track their contributions, and provide feedback. Power Apps empowers non-profits to build user-friendly interfaces that enhance engagement and strengthen stakeholder relationships.
6. Cost-Effective Solution:
Non-profit organizations often operate with limited budgets and need cost-effective technology solutions. Microsoft Power Apps offers an affordable option for building custom applications compared to traditional software development methods. With Power Apps, non-profits can create powerful applications without extensive coding or expensive IT resources. This cost-effective approach allows non-profits to allocate resources more efficiently and focus on achieving their mission.
